Temptation: Confessions of a Marriage Counselor (2013) Review by Steve Pulaski from United States
"Overwrought" is the word to describe Tyler Perry's Temptation. Betweenthe simple conflicts, cardboard characters, and stiflingly slow dialogalmost entirely erected off of carbon-copy dramas, it shows itsagonizingly long roots by taking every possible scenario and stretchingit to a length beyond maddening tedium. There's almost no need to evenwrite a review on this picture, because if you're not turned off by thename "Tyler Perry," you're likely turned off by the amateur cast thefilm boasts, the dopey plot(s), or the presence of the always wooden,never charismatic Kim Kardashian.

Tyler Perry's films have been a roller-coaster for a non-fan likemyself. I believe his pictures almost demand the audience to haveability to relate too its characters on screen, and if you don't, thenyou've demolished one of the crucial ways of being able to like thefilm as a whole. But if you even if you do have the relatable factordown, there are still a number of other characteristics of his picturesthat will do the job of turning you off. The abundance of clichés,stereotypes, senseless slapstick, religious motives, and ridiculouscharacters is enough to warrant a walk-out.

The film stars Jurnee Smollett-Bell and Lance Gross as Judith andBrice, childhood sweethearts that are married in an upper-class area.She is a matchmaker, working to become a full-time marriage counselor,while he is a pharmacist and a successful one at that. After six yearsof marriage, Judith becomes greatly unsatisfied by the drab life she isliving, and in due-time because she meets Harley (Robbie Jones), animmensely successful, social-networking pioneer who is in dire need ofa woman. From first sight, Judith is mesmerized by his confidence,money, and ability to talk a woman up as big as the house he lives in.We see where this is going, but Judith, who appears very bright andfocused - with a mind similar to Kimberly Elise's character in Diary ofa Mad Black Woman - doesn't. Soon, they are sneaking around, havingsexual fun together, while she is being showered with gifts, all whiletrying to remain indiscreet to Brice.

This is the immediate problem of Tyler Perry's Temptation; there are nolikable characters (except Brice), no characters with any intelligentjudgment, and no characters that extend themselves past formulaic anddull. Take Judith for example, who we are allegedly supposed tosympathize with, even during the instances when she is cheating. We'rejust supposed to think, "well, it's justifiable since she's upset andBrice doesn't stand up for her as a man should." There's nojustification for cheating, but the film makes it out to be up untilthings go really, really wrong.

It's, too, relevant that the film loves making ordeals out of pettynon-issues such as Brice not standing up for Judith when she iscat-called by a group of thugs on their night out. Judith proceeds togo to bed angry and embarrassed by her husband's lack of gall to defendher or even initiate something. A scene not long after shows Harleyalmost beating a cyclist to a pulp after running into Judith when shewas clearly at fault. Is he how men should behave? The film tries toshow us that, even though his actions are grossly immature compared toBrice's, he's better because he at least tries.

Tyler Perry's Temptation fails in large part, however, because of itswriting. It is an early candidate for the worst written film of theyear. It runs on the fuel of inane dialog, corny lines, and senselessdrama. Take for example the scene when Harley and Judith are on hisprivate plane, and Harley questions what Judith "dreams about." Whenshe responds, she ricochets the question off of him, to which hereplies, "of you?" in a delivery that is akin to primetime soap operas.I can't remember cringing harder to a line of dialog. Then there's ascene where Judith is found battered in a bathtub. When Brice asks her,"where does it hurt?" she replies, "here," while placing her hand onhis heart. To see the audience eat scenes up like this makes me deeply,deeply scared to think they have romantic expectations probably notalien to the kind in this film.

The leads aren't dreadful here, as Smollett-Bell and Gross are the kindof actors you crave to Streaming in better material, but the presence ofreality-TV star Kim Kardashian in a film is about as off-putting and astasteless as the persona she gives on that godforsaken program ofher's. Why must Kardashian inhabit a secondary role in this film, letalone a role at all? Why not find a bodacious woman with huge breasts,a huge buttocks, and wildly unrealistic curves with no celebrity appealfor half the price? Perry's name alone is big enough to sell the mostlurid screenplay/movie, so why work a role for her? It doesn't matter,though; I'm wasting words. She's about as unappealing and cloying as asecondary character played by an unnecessary celebrity can get. It willtake a performance of a true despicable nature to dethrone her from a"Worst New Actress" award at the forthcoming Razzies.

Tyler Perry's Temptation is a sermon that will effectively preach tothe choir that has graciously accepted every film he has released sinceDiary of a Mad Black Woman back in 2005. However, it has become clearnow that public success is all that matters to Perry. He no longerseems to have ambition to make films that cater to a denominator otherthan the lowest or the most demanding. He attempts to get by onmelodramatic clichés, laughable dialog, moral preachiness, inclusionsof a sappy Christian agenda, and frustratingly inert plotpoints. I wishhim well, and hope one day I can recommend a movie by him. I respecthim as a self-made filmmaker, but that's about it, I'm afraid.


Temptation: Confessions of a Marriage Counselor (2013) Review by emartin-1 from South Florida

There are many things to admire about Tyler Perry. His ascent in theentertainment industry is incredible, and he has used his powereffectively to give a voice to the African-American experience the sameway Woody Allen has for the Jewish experience. He gives opportunitiesto young African-Americans actors and veterans such as Cicely Tyson whowould struggle to find work elsewhere. Perry is a shrewd, powerfulbusinessman. But he's a horrible director and mediocre writer. Hislatest project "Temptation" is his worst to date. The premise not onlystraddles the lines of implausibility, it's downright ridiculous. Agirl-next-door-type (Jurnee Smollett-Bell) who is married to a man shehas known since they were both 6 years old suddenly decides to have anaffair with one of her clients. She also starts to snort cocaine andhang out in seedy nightclubs. A subplot involving actress/singer Brandyis also dumb, and the plot twist at the end is the icing on the cake tothis mess. When the credits began rolling, the reaction in my theaterfelt like a collective "Are you kidding me?" Perhaps it only makessense that Kim Kardashian is in this movie. Remember in algebra classwhen we learned that a negative and a positive always equal a negative?That's what the scenes between Kardashian and Smollett-Bell produce.One can act, one can't. You do the math. Perry also needs to stop withthe pointless close-up shots and phony eye-drop tears. Although withthis flop, it's the audience members who paid $10 who should be crying.
